Leopardi is a crater on Mercury.[1] Its name was adopted by the International Astronomical Union in 1976. Leopardi is named for the Italian writer Giacomo Leopardi, who lived from 1798 to 1837.[2]

An escarpment called Altair Rupes cuts across Leopardi crater. It extends to the east and to the northwest from the crater.[3]
